Understanding Gratuity in UAE
- Eligibility: Minimum 1 year of continuous service.
- Calculation:
- 1–5 years: 21 days’ basic salary per year.
- 5+ years: 30 days’ basic salary per year.
- Cap: Cannot exceed 2 years’ salary.
- Payout Deadline: Employers must release gratuity within 14 days of contract termination.
- Resignation Cases: Under the new labor law, even if you resign, you are entitled to gratuity (with no deductions as in the old law). For a detailed explanation, please read the article on the gratuity calculation process in the UAE.
Why a Claim Letter Matters
- Acts as a formal request to HR or management.
- Shows professionalism and seriousness.
- Provides a written record in case of future dispute.
- Helps HR process payment faster with all details ready.
Information to Include in Your Letter
- Your full name and employee ID.
- Job title and department.
- Start and end date of service.
- Mention of years completed.
- Reference to UAE Labor Law entitlement.
- Request for gratuity release.

Step-by-Step Writing Guide
Step 1 – Start with Addressing the Employer: Write to the HR Manager or employer, including the company’s name and address.
Step 2 – Add a Clear Subject Line: Example: “Request for Release of End-of-Service Gratuity Payment.”
Step 3 – Introduce Yourself: State your name, employee ID, designation, and years of service.
Step 4 – Mention Eligibility: Refer to UAE labor law and highlight your right to gratuity benefits.
Step 5 – Make a Formal Request: Politely request the processing and release of your gratuity payment.
Step 6 – Close Professionally: Thank them for their cooperation and sign with your name.
Standard Format
To,
The Human Resource Manager,
Company Name ____________
Address ____________
_/_/____ (Date)
Subject: Request for Gratuity Payment
Sir/Madam,
I am [Your Full Name], having served as [Your Job Title] with employee ID [ID] from [Start Date] to [End Date]. As per the UAE labor law, I am entitled to an end-of-service gratuity for my [X years] of continuous service.
Therefore, I respectfully request the release of my gratuity benefits in due process. Kindly let me know if any further documents are required to complete this claim.
Looking forward to your positive response.
Sincerely,
____________ (Your Name)
____________ (Signature)

Tips for Employees
- Submit the letter in writing and keep a copy for yourself.
- Attach supporting documents (Emirates ID, service certificate, salary slip).
- Remind HR of the 14-day legal payout requirement.
- Follow up politely if no response is received.
- If payment is delayed, you can escalate to MOHRE (for mainland) or the respective free zone authority.
